Transaction ecfb3dcd1b64e7df79d248bac1b1123ee78e939a7ea40bd326bb5b5563a50261
1 Input
1 Output
-
ecfb3dcd1b64e7df79d248bac1b1123ee78e939a7ea40bd326bb5b5563a50261:0
- value
- 40700
- script pubkey
- OP_0 OP_PUSHBYTES_20 38c7c95e8b34765a1ad3d08eccf3c60627b075d5
- address
- bc1q8rrujh5tx3m95xkn6z8veu7xqcnmqaw4n7w89h